Output e5f74f5b5446099bb2795dae7226aeabf33fd57d66c53bc0bb5aa80024b738b0:10

value
896000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2c2ecf13773599c51bb4e5222e0e498ce538e76 OP_EQUAL
address
3NN29ZaQw5qEtWui2v6X81EvZEnGH9L62a
transaction
e5f74f5b5446099bb2795dae7226aeabf33fd57d66c53bc0bb5aa80024b738b0
spent
true